derek has some nickels and dimes worth $3.60. the number of dimes is one more than twice the number of nickels. how many nickels and dimes does he have?

Let n= # of nickels and d= # of dimes. And we know the total is $3.60 So 0.05n + 0.10d = 3.60 Because a nickel is $0.05 and a dime is 0.10

And the number of dimes is one more thantwice the number of nickels So d= 1 + 2n Using these two equations, you can use substitution to find n and d
